adjective
- paying careful attention; being cautious and alert
Examples
- The heedful driver slowed down when she saw the icy road conditions.
- Parents should be heedful of their children’s online activities.
- The heedful student double-checked all her answers before submitting the test.
- He remained heedful of his doctor’s warnings about his diet.
- The heedful investor researched thoroughly before making any decisions.
- She was heedful of the time and left early to avoid traffic.
